Clinical Approach & Modalities

Genna balances specialized behavioral protocols with narrative and existential exploration to help clients rewrite their personal stories while gaining mastery over their symptoms:

  • Evidence-Based OCD, OC Related Disorders, Anxiety & Habit Treatment:
    • Exposure and Response Prevention (ERP) and
    • Habit Reversal Training (HRT) to target compulsions and body-focused repetitive behaviors.
    • Acceptance and Commitment Therapy (ACT) to foster psychological flexibility and values-based living.
    • Inference-based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(I-CBT) to target the root of obsessional doubt.
  • Meaning-Centered & Narrative Growth:
    • Narrative Therapy to help clients externalize their problems.
    • Existential Therapy to explore personal agency, freedom, and the search for meaning.
  • Mindfulness & Values:
    • Acceptance and Commitment Therapy (ACT) to build psychological flexibility and help clients move toward what truly matters to them.
  • Empathetic Foundation:
    • Person-Centered Therapy (PCT) to ensure the therapeutic relationship is grounded in unconditional positive regard and genuine collaboration.
